• Privacywetgeving
    Het is bij Helpmij.nl niet toegestaan om persoonsgegevens in een voorbeeld te plaatsen. Alle voorbeelden die persoonsgegevens bevatten zullen zonder opgaaf van reden verwijderd worden. In de vraag zal specifiek vermeld moeten worden dat het om fictieve namen gaat.

melding alleen lezen

Status
Niet open voor verdere reacties.

janus1janus1

Gebruiker
Lid geworden
7 apr 2005
Berichten
103
In diverse programma's die ik geschreven heb moet ik een aantal bestanden raadplegen die op een netwerk staan. Als een bestand dan geopend wordt maak ik gebruik van de opdracht
if activeworkbook.readonly = true then... etc
Bij deze code bepaal ik of ik door kan gaan of niet. Daarnaast krijg ik ook nog eens de standaardmelding dat het bestand elders in gebruik is. Kan ik dit omzeilen?
Ik gebruik al de opdracht application.displayalert = false maar de "alleen lezen" boodschap blijft komen.

weet iemand hiervoor een oplossing
bvd
Janus
 
gebruik voor het openen van de sheet de volgende code
Workbooks.Open FileName:=MySheet, ReadOnly:=True, IgnoreReadOnlyRecommended:=True

MySheet is uiteraard jouw bestand.
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an